Frequently Asked Questions
Warp
What is this tool?
Warp is a modern terminal that integrates AI to provide real-time code completions and collaboration features for developers.
How much does it cost?
Warp offers a free tier with basic features and paid plans starting at $20/month for advanced AI and team collaboration.
Does it have a free plan?
Yes, Warp provides a free plan with essential AI completions and terminal functionalities.
What integrations does it support?
Warp primarily integrates within its terminal environment; no public third-party integrations are documented.
Who is it best for?
Warp is best suited for developers and small teams who prefer terminal workflows enhanced by AI-assisted coding.
Getimg
What is this tool?
Getimg is an AI tool that generates images from text prompts for creatives and marketers.
How much does it cost?
Getimg offers a free plan and paid subscriptions starting at $20/month.
Does it have a free plan?
Yes, Getimg provides a free tier with limited daily credits.
What integrations does it support?
Getimg currently does not support third-party integrations or public APIs.
Who is it best for?
It is best for individuals and small teams needing easy, fast AI image generation.
